South Africa beat India

In a thrilling match, South Africa beat India at the ACA-VDCA stadium at PM Palem in Visakhapatnam on 9 October, scoring their third win in the ICC Women’s Cricket World Championship.

Choosing to field first after winning the toss, the South Africa team restricted India to 251 runs. India was in trouble when it lost six wickets for just 102 runs. However, a brilliant performance by Richa Ghosh, who made 94 runs in 77 balls, helped India make a decent score of 251 runs.

Chasing the target, South Africa finished it in 48.5 overs. South Africa player Klerk steered the team to victory with her superb show in the ICC Women’s Cricket World Championship.
